What You'll Need Before You Start
Okay, before we jump into the actual renewal process, let's make sure you have everything you need at your fingertips. Think of it as gathering your supplies before starting a recipe – it just makes everything smoother. First up, you'll need your vehicle's title number. This is usually found on your current registration card or your vehicle title. Make sure you have it handy, as you'll need to enter it exactly as it appears. Next, you'll need your vehicle's license plate number. This one's pretty straightforward – just double-check that you're entering it correctly. After that, you'll need your insurance information. This includes the name of your insurance company and your policy number. It's a good idea to have your insurance card nearby to ensure you're providing accurate details. You'll also need your driver's license or photo ID. While you won't need to physically present it online, you'll need to know the information on it, such as your driver's license number. It's always a good idea to have it with you just in case. Finally, you'll need a valid credit card or debit card to pay the renewal fee. Make sure your card is active and has sufficient funds to cover the cost. It's also a good idea to check your card's daily spending limit to avoid any unexpected issues. Step-by-Step Guide to Online Renewal
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and walk through the online renewal process step-by-step. First, head over to the official Pennsylvania Department of Transportation (PennDOT) website. You can easily find it by searching "PennDOT vehicle registration renewal" on Google. Make sure you're on the official PennDOT site to avoid any scams or unofficial services. Once you're on the site, look for the section related to vehicle registration renewal. It's usually prominently displayed on the homepage or in the online services menu. Click on the link to access the online renewal portal. You'll likely be prompted to create an account or log in if you already have one. If you're a first-time user, you'll need to provide some basic information to create an account. This usually includes your name, address, email address, and a password. Once you're logged in, you'll be asked to enter your vehicle information. This is where you'll need the vehicle title number, license plate number, and insurance information that we gathered earlier. Double-check that you're entering everything correctly to avoid any errors. Next, you'll be asked to verify your information. Take a moment to review everything you've entered to ensure it's accurate. If you spot any mistakes, correct them before moving on. After verifying your information, you'll be prompted to pay the renewal fee. The fee will vary depending on your vehicle type and other factors. You can usually pay with a credit card or debit card. Enter your payment information and follow the instructions to complete the transaction. Once your payment is processed, you'll receive a confirmation message. This confirms that your renewal has been submitted successfully. You'll also receive a receipt for your payment, which you should save for your records. Finally, your renewed registration card will be mailed to your address on file. It usually takes a few days to arrive, so be patient. In the meantime, you can print out a temporary registration card from the PennDOT website to keep in your vehicle. And that's it! You've successfully renewed your car registration in PA online. Common Issues and How to Solve Them
Even with a straightforward process, sometimes things can go a little sideways. Let's cover some common issues you might encounter while renewing your car registration online and, more importantly, how to solve them. First off, you might run into trouble if your vehicle isn't eligible for online renewal. This could be due to various reasons, such as outstanding violations, suspensions, or specific vehicle types. If this happens, you'll usually receive a message indicating why your vehicle isn't eligible and what steps you need to take to resolve the issue. Another common problem is entering incorrect information. This could be anything from a typo in your vehicle title number to an incorrect insurance policy number. Always double-check the information you're entering to avoid errors. If you do make a mistake, the system will usually flag it and prompt you to correct it. Payment issues are another potential hurdle. Sometimes, your credit card or debit card might be declined due to insufficient funds, incorrect billing information, or other reasons. Make sure your card is active and has sufficient funds to cover the renewal fee. If you continue to experience payment issues, try using a different card or contacting your bank for assistance. Technical glitches can also occur from time to time. This could be due to website maintenance, server issues, or other technical problems. If you encounter a technical glitch, try refreshing the page or clearing your browser's cache and cookies. If the problem persists, try again later or contact PennDOT's customer service for assistance. Finally, you might experience delays in receiving your renewed registration card in the mail. This could be due to postal delays, processing delays, or other unforeseen circumstances. If you haven't received your card within a reasonable timeframe, you can usually track its status online or contact PennDOT's customer service for updates. Remember, it's always a good idea to keep a copy of your temporary registration card in your vehicle until your renewed card arrives.
